NBA Cup: Trae Young trolls Knicks with logo dice roll as Hawks storm for comeback win into semifinals
How does this make you feel?



The New York Knicks led the Atlanta Hawks in the NBA Cup quarterfinal, but Atlanta staged a comeback in the third quarter to secure a 108-100 victory and advance to the semifinals against the Milwaukee Bucks. Trae Young led the charge with 22 points, 11 assists, and five rebounds, while Jalen Johnson and De’Andre Hunter contributed heavily to the win with strong performances. Despite a balanced effort from the Knicks, led by Josh Hart and Karl-Anthony Towns, they were unable to overcome Atlanta’s dominant rebounding and offensive display, ultimately leading to their elimination from the NBA Cup.

Knicks Expected To Add Charles Allen, Riccardo Fois To Coaching Staff

The New York Knicks are set to add Charles Allen and Riccardo Fois to Mike Brown's coaching staff, both of whom previously worked with Brown at the Kings. The team will not retain assistant coaches Othella Harrington, Daniel Brady, Dice Yoshimoto, and assistant video coordinator Nick Thibodeau, while also seeking to interview Pablo Prigioni for the top assistant role. Jamal Cain, Magic Sign Two-Way Contract

The Orlando Magic have signed forward Jamal Cain to a Two-Way contract following his stint with the New Orleans Pelicans, where he averaged 5.3 points and 2.3 rebounds over 37 games last season. Cain, an undrafted player with experience from the Miami Heat, has career averages of 4.8 points and 2.1 rebounds in 81 NBA games, and impressive G League stats of 21.6 points and 9.3 rebounds per game. Damian Lillard Reflects On Time With Bucks, Calls Injuries 'Biggest Hurdle' To Championship

Damian Lillard discussed his two-year stint with the Milwaukee Bucks, attributing the team's inability to reach championship heights to injuries. Despite averaging 25 points and seven assists, Lillard emphasized that health issues, including significant injuries during playoff runs, hindered their potential, but praised his partnership with Giannis Antetokounmpo as a valuable experience.
